Bicyclist Injured In Crash With Pickup Truck In Lehigh Valley, Police Say A 62-year-old bicyclist was injured in a crash with a pickup truck in the Lehigh Valley, authorities said. The wreck happened on Airport Road near Avenue A in Hanover Township around 2:45 p.m. on Tuesday, Oct. 18, Pennsylvania State Police said. A 2006 Dodge Ram 1500 driven by a 52-year-old man from Bath collied with a 2020 Terra Trike Maverick bike, police said. The Bethlehem bicyclist, who was wearing a helmet, was treated at the scene before being brought to Lehigh Valley Hospital - Muhlenberg.  The driver was not injured and was wearing a seatbelt at the time …

Three Men Convicted In Murderous Berks County Drug Trafficking Ring Three men were convicted on multiple charges for their roles in a murderous drug trafficking ring operating in Berks County, authorities said. Jesus Feliciano-Trinidad, 33, Dewayne Quinones, 29, and Mayco Alvarez-Jackson, 25, all of Reading, were found guilty at trial of murder, kidnapping, drug distribution, and firearms offenses, United States Attorney Jacqueline C. Romero and Berks County District Attorney John T. Adams announced on Thursday, Oct. 20. The organization was responsible for multiple homicides, kidnappings, and conspiracies to kidnap in 2017 and 2018, including a q…

Fatal Shooting In Allentown Was Self-Defense, DA Says An Allentown resident was defending themself when they fatally shot a man who forced his way into a home with three others this past summer, authorities have ruled. "The homicide was justified on the basis of self-defense," Lehigh County District Attorney Jim Martin announced on Wednesday, Oct. 19. The trouble began on the 700 block of North 11th Street on July 9. Edwin Diaz-Rivera, 37, and the home's residents got into a dispute that investigators say was paused when Diaz-Rivera told them he would return to the home with weapons and other people. Elderly Man Suffers Traumatic Brain Injury After Being Struck By Car In Bucks County: Police An elderly man suffered a traumatic brain injury after being struck by a car in Bucks County, authorities said. The 66-year-old pedestrian was hit by the vehicle not far from where he lived on Street Road just east of Taylor Avenue around 7:30 a.m. on Wednesday, Oct. 12, Warrington Township police said. A police lieutenant who was already in the area stopped at the scene within a minute of being notified, and began providing lifesaving medical care to the man, authorities said. The township resident was left with an open head wound and severe head trauma, police said.  …

Authorities ID Driver Killed In Route 422 Crash In Berks County Authorities have identified the driver killed in a crash involving a tractor-trailer on Route 422 in Berks County on Tuesday, Oct. 18. Justine Twardowski, 27, was behind the wheel of a northbound sedan that was struck by a tractor-trailer traveling eastbound at Ben Franklin Highway (Rt. 422) and Riverbridge Road in the Douglassville area around 10:20 a.m., Amity Township Police Chief Jeffrey Smith said. The Birdsboro woman died, but the tractor-trailer driver, 52-year-old Leslie Thompson, Jr. of Steelton, escaped unharmed, the chief added. Both drivers were wearing seat belts at the time&n…

Bucks Resident Cut By Political Signs Rigged With Razor Blades, Police Say Police in Bucks County are investigating after they say a resident was cut by razor-rigged political signs strategically placed in their yard. A booby-trapped campaign sign for Democratic gubernatorial candidate Josh Shapiro, among two others, were placed without permission on the resident's property, Upper Makefield police said in a Sunday, Oct. 16 Facebook post. When the homeowner tried to remove the sign, they were cut by the razor blades taped around the edges of the board, authorities said.
